Manufacturer's Description: Beyonce Heat Rush is Beyonce's follow-up fragrance to her successful Heat perfume from 2010. Beyonce Heat Rush shines, sparkles and excites the moment it touches the skin. Surrounded by a luminous fragrant aura, the woman who wears it feels instantly effervescent and alive. Sensual and bright, the scent lights up a room just as Beyonce captivates with her presence.
Beyonce Heat Rush instantly captures attention with sparkling top notes of passion fruit, blood orange and Brazilian cherry.
The heart of the fragrance embodies Beyonce's ultra-feminine side. A delicate floral bouquet is built upon a carefully blended combination of Yellow Tiger Orchid, Mango Blossom and Orange Hibiscus.
Subtle and alluring, the unforgettable base engages with hints of teak wood, honey amber and a musk accord that is inspired by the sunsets in Brazil.
